But in 1903, cyclists weren't enthusiastic about what was pitched to them as a heroic race through roads more suited to hooves than wheels, with bikes weighing up to 44 pounds, on a single fixed gear, for three full weeks. The first Tour De France was a far cry from the polished international sporting event we see on television today. Through these characters' backstories, Cossins paints a nuanced portrait of France in the early 1900s. Assembling enough riders for the race meant bribing unemployed laborers from the suburbs of Paris,
